There's new hope in Baton Rouge for people suffering from mental health and substance abuse problems.

The Bridge Center for Hope held a walk-through yesterday and announced that they will be help residents in the parish who have mental health or substance abuse needs.

According to reports, the center provides a detox unit, a psychiatric unit, hot meals, a laundry facility, and a place to sleep.

It will also provide help for any community members in need, as well as people working in emergency rooms and jails.

The Bridge Center for Hope will open to the public for a walk-through today from 9 a.m. to 3 p.m. The center will open its doors and begin accepting patients later this month.
